Stephen Appiah's son Rodney joins Great Olympics training ahead of new GPL season

Rodney Appiah, the son of former Black Stars captain Stephen Appiah, has begun preseason training with Great Olympics ahead of the start of the 2021-22 Ghana Premier League season.

Appiah, who was promoted to the senior team last season, hopes to get into the first-team group this season.

Last season, he made his Ghana Premier League debut against Liberty Professionals at the Accra Sports Stadium on matchday 22, which his team won 2-0.

Rodney was recruited by Great Olympics from KingStep FC in the second transfer window after excelling on trials.

Rodney Appiah is extremely talented, much like his father, and aspires to outperform him. He took part in the club’s pre-season friendlies.
